what is the origin of abductor digiti quinti/minimi?

pisiform

2
New cards

what is the insertion of abductor digiti quinti/minimi?

proximal phalanx/digit 5

3
New cards

what action does abductor digiti quinti/minimi carry out?

abducts digit 5

4
New cards

what is the innervation of abductor digiti quinti/minimi?

ulnar nerve

5
New cards

what is the origin of flexor digiti quinti/minimi?

hamate

6
New cards

what is the insertion of flexor digiti quinti/minimi?

proximal phalanx/digit 5

7
New cards

what action does the flexor digiti quinti/minimi carry out?

flexes digit 5 at MP joint

8
New cards

what is the innervation of flexor digiti quinti/minimi?

ulnar nerve

9
New cards

what is the origin of opponens digiti quinti/minimi?

hamate

10
New cards

what is the insertion of opponens digiti quinti/minimi?

5th metacarpal

11
New cards

what action does opponens digiti quinti/minimi carry out?

laterally rotates 5th metacarpal

12
New cards

what is the innervation of opponens digiti quinti/minimi?

ulnar nerve

13
New cards

what are the origins of the lumbricles?

tendons of the flexor digitorum profundus muscle

14
New cards

what are the insertions of the lumbricles?

tendons of the extensor digitorum muscle

15
New cards

what actions do the lumbricles carry out?

1. flex MP joints

2. extend IP joints

16
New cards

What is the innervtion of the 1st and 2nd lumbricles?

median nerve

17
New cards

what is the innervation of the 3rd and 4th lumbricles?

ulnar nerve

18
New cards

what are the origins of the dorsal interossei?

2nd, 3rd, and 4th metacarpals

19
New cards

what are the insertions of the dorsal interossei?

proximal phalanx of digits 2, 3, and 4

20
New cards

what actions do the dorsal interossei carry out?

1. abduct digits 2-4

2. flex MP joints

3. extend IP joints

21
New cards

what is the innervation of the dorsal interossei?

ulnar nerve

22
New cards

what are the origins of the palmar interossei?

2nd, 3rd, 4th, and 5th metacarpals

23
New cards

what are the insertions of the palmar interossei?

proximal phalanx of digits 2, 4, and 5

24
New cards

what actions do the palmar interossei carry out?

1. adduct digits 2, 4, and 5

2. flex MP joints

3. extend IP joints

25
New cards

what is the innervation of the palmar interossei?

what are the origins of abductor pollicis brevis?

1. trapezium

2. scaphoid

27
New cards

what is the insertion of abductor pollicis brevis?

proximal phalanx/digit 1

28
New cards

what action does abductor pollicis brevis carry out?

abducts digit 1 at MP joint

29
New cards

what is the innervation of abductor pollicis brevis?

median nerve

30
New cards

what is the origin of opponens pollicis?

trapezium

31
New cards

what is the insertion of opponens pollicis?

1st metacarpal

32
New cards

what action does opponens pollicis carry out?

medially rotates 1st metacarpal

33
New cards

what is the innervation of opponens pollicis?

median nerve

34
New cards

what are the origins of flexor pollicis brevis?

1. trapezium

2. trapezoid

3. capitate bones

35
New cards

what is the insertion of flexor pollicis brevis?

proximal phalanx/digit 1

36
New cards

what action does flexor pollicis brevis carry out?

flexes digit 1 at MP joint

37
New cards

what is the innervation of flexor pollicis brevis?

1. ulnar nerve

2. median nerve

38
New cards

what are the origins of adductor pollicis?

1. trapezoid

2. capitate

3. 2nd metacarpal (oblique head)

4. 3rd metacarpal (oblique and transverse heads)

39
New cards

what is the insertion of adductor pollicis?

proximal phalanx/digit 1

40
New cards

what action does adductor pollicis carry out?

adducts digit 1

41
New cards

what is the innervation of adductor pollicis?

ulnar nerve

42
New cards

what are the origins of supinator?

1. lateral epicondyle/humerus

2. supinator crest/ulna

43
New cards

what is the insertion of supinator?

shaft/radius

44
New cards

what action does supinator carry out?

supinates forearm

45
New cards

what is the innervation of supinator?

radial nerve

46
New cards

what are the origins of abductor pollicis longus?

interosseous membrane

47
New cards

what is the insertion of abductor pollicis longus?

first metacarpal

48
New cards

what actions does abductor pollicis longus carry out?

1. abducts digit 1 at CM joint

2. extends digit 1

49
New cards

what is the innervation of abductor pollicis longus?

radial nerve

50
New cards

what are the origins of extensor pollicis brevis?

1. shaft/radius

2. interosseous membrane

51
New cards

what is the insertion of extensor pollicis brevis?

proximal phalanx/digit 1

52
New cards

what action does extensor pollicis brevis carry out?

extends digit 1 at MP joint

53
New cards

what is the innervation of extensor pollicis brevis?

radial nerve

54
New cards

what are the origins of extensor pollicis longus?

1. shaft/ulna

2. interosseous membrane

55
New cards

what is the insertion of extensor pollicis longus?

distal phalanx/digit 1

56
New cards

what action does extensor pollicis longus carry out?

extends digit 1 at IP joint

57
New cards

what is the innervation of extensor pollicis longus?

radial nerve

58
New cards

what are the origins of extensor indicis?

interosseous membrane

59
New cards

what is the insertion of extensor indicis?

proximal phalanx/digit 2

60
New cards

what actions does extensor indicis carry out?

extends digit 2

61
New cards

what is the innervation of extensor indicis?

radial nerve

62
New cards

what is the origin of anconeus?

lateral epicondyle/humerus

63
New cards

what are the insertions of anconeus?

1. olecranon process

2. posterior proximal shaft/ulna

64
New cards

what action does anconeus carry out?

extends forearm

65
New cards

what is the innervation of anconeus?

radial nerve

66
New cards

what is the origin of the brachioradialis?

lateral supracondylar ridge/humerus

67
New cards

what is the insertion of the brachioradialis?

styloid process/radius

68
New cards

what actions does the brachioradialis carry out?

1. helps flex forearm

2. pronates the forearm

3. supinates the forearm

69
New cards

what is the innervation of the brachioradialis?

radial nerve

70
New cards

what is the origin of the extensor carpi radialis longus?

lateral epicondyle/humerus

71
New cards

what is the insertion of the extensor carpi radialis longus?

second metacarpal

72
New cards

what actions does the extensor carpi radialis longus carry out?

1. extends the hand

2. abducts the hand

73
New cards

what is the innervation of the extensor carpi radialis longus?

radial nerve

74
New cards

what is the origin of the extensor carpi radialis brevis?

lateral epicondyle/humerus

75
New cards

what is the insertion of the extensor carpi radialis brevis?

third metacarpal

76
New cards

what actions does the extensor carpi radialus brevis carry out?

1. extends the hand

2. abducts the hand

77
New cards

what is the innervation of the extensor carpi radialis brevis?

radial nerve

78
New cards

what is the origin of the extensor digitorum (maximus)?

lateral epicondyle/humerus

79
New cards

what are the insertions of the extensor digitorum (maximus)?

middle and distal phalanges of digits 2-5

80
New cards

what actions does the extensor digitorum (maximus) carry out?

1. extends digits 2-5

2. extends the hand

81
New cards

what is the innervation of the extensor digitorum (maximus)?

radial nerve

82
New cards

what is the origin of the extensor digiti minimi?

lateral epicondyle/humerus

83
New cards

what is the insertion of the extensor digiti minimi?

proximal phalanx/digit 5

84
New cards

what action does the extensor digiti minimi carry out?

extends digit 5 (little finger)

85
New cards

what is the innervation of the extensor digiti minimi?

radial nerve

86
New cards

what are the origins of the extensor carpi ulnaris?

1. lateral epicondyle/humerus

2. shaft/ulna

87
New cards

what is the insertion of the extensor carpi ulnaris?

5th metacarpal

88
New cards

what actions does the extensor carpi ulnaris carry out?

1. extends hand

2. helps adduct hand

89
New cards

what is the innervation of the extensor carpi ulnaris?

radial nerve

90
New cards

what are the origins of the flexor digitorum profundus?

1. shaft/ulna

2. interosseous membrane

91
New cards

what are the insertions of the flexor digitorum profundus?

distal phalanges of digits 2-5

92
New cards

what actions does the flexor digitorum profundus carry out?

1. flexes DIP joints of digits 2-5

2. helps flex hand

93
New cards

what is the innervation of the flexor digitorum profundus?

ulnar nerve and median nerve

94
New cards

what are the origins of the flexor pollicis longus?

interosseous membrane

95
New cards

what is the insertion of the flexor pollicis longus?

distal phalanx/digit 1

96
New cards

what action does the flexor pollicis longus carry out?

flexes the thumb (digit 1) at the IP joint

97
New cards

what is innervation of the flexor pollicis longus?

median nerve

98
New cards

what is the origin of the pronator quadratus?

distial aneterior shaft/ulna

99
New cards

what is the insertion of the pronator quadratus?

distal anterior shaft/radius

100
New cards

what actions does the pronator quadratus carry out?

1. pronation of the forearm at the inferior radio-ulnar joint

2. helps stabilize the inferior radio-ulnar joint
